1. Gauge

The “12” in “12 gauge” denotes the bore diameter of the shotgun and is prime to understanding compatibility with ammunition like Federal’s 12-gauge goal hundreds. This designation represents a historic measurement system the place twelve lead spheres, every equal to the bore diameter, would weigh one pound. This understanding is essential for protected and efficient use of any 12-gauge shotgun.

  • Bore Diameter and Shot Shell Compatibility

    The 12-gauge designation signifies a particular bore diameter of roughly 0.729 inches. This measurement instantly dictates the dimensions and kind of shotshells that may be safely fired. Utilizing ammunition of an incorrect gauge can result in harmful malfunctions or catastrophic failure. Federal goal hundreds designated as 12 gauge are manufactured to those particular dimensions, guaranteeing protected operation in appropriately chambered firearms.

  • Historic Context of Gauge Measurement

    The gauge system originates from a time when smoothbore firearms have been designated based mostly on the variety of lead balls of bore diameter that will equal one pound. A 12-gauge, subsequently, traditionally implied that twelve lead balls of that bore diameter would weigh one pound. Whereas fashionable ammunition has developed considerably, the gauge system persists as a normal measure of bore diameter.

4. Shot sort

The selection between lead and metal shot inside Federal 12-gauge goal hundreds considerably impacts efficiency traits and environmental concerns. This distinction necessitates cautious choice based mostly on the particular goal capturing software and prevailing laws. The composition of the shot influences each the ballistic properties of the ammunition and its environmental influence.

Lead shot, traditionally the usual for goal capturing, presents a number of efficiency benefits. Its increased density interprets to better momentum and power retention downrange, leading to more practical goal breaking. Nevertheless, issues concerning lead’s toxicity within the surroundings have led to restrictions on its use in sure areas, significantly for waterfowl searching. In response, metal shot has emerged as a viable different. Whereas much less dense than lead, developments in metal shot expertise have improved its efficiency traits, although variations in ballistic properties in comparison with lead stay. These variations typically necessitate changes in choke choice and capturing strategies to attain optimum outcomes. For instance, metal shot typically requires a extra open choke attributable to its decrease density and tendency to sample tighter. Understanding these nuances permits shooters to decide on the suitable shot sort for each efficiency and environmental compliance.

6. Recoil

Manageable recoil is a essential attribute of Federal 12-gauge goal hundreds, instantly influencing shooter consolation and efficiency, significantly throughout prolonged capturing classes frequent in disciplines like entice, skeet, and sporting clays. Recoil, the backward momentum imparted to the shotgun when fired, is a product of the bodily ideas of momentum conservation. The mass and velocity of the ejecta (shot and wad) and propellant gases exiting the barrel generate an equal and reverse response pressure on the firearm. This pressure, perceived as recoil, can have an effect on shooter accuracy and luxury, particularly with repeated photographs. Goal hundreds are particularly designed to mitigate recoil, permitting for extra managed and pleasant capturing experiences. This administration is achieved by way of cautious balancing of propellant cost and shot payload.

The connection between recoil and shooter efficiency is critical. Extreme recoil can result in flinching, anticipating the recoil impulse, which negatively impacts accuracy and consistency. Moreover, heavy recoil can induce fatigue, additional degrading efficiency over time. Federal’s goal hundreds handle these points by providing manageable recoil profiles, enabling shooters to take care of give attention to goal acquisition and follow-through with out undue discomfort or disruption. This attribute is especially useful for novice shooters creating correct method and skilled rivals taking part in high-volume capturing occasions. For instance, in a aggressive entice capturing surroundings, the place constant accuracy over a number of rounds is crucial, manageable recoil ensures sustained efficiency by minimizing fatigue and selling constant capturing mechanics. Equally, in skeet, the place speedy goal acquisition and engagement are essential, managed recoil permits for smoother transitions between photographs, enhancing general accuracy and effectivity.

7. Wad Kind

Wad sort inside Federal 12-gauge goal hundreds is a vital, but typically ignored, element influencing efficiency. The wad, positioned between the powder and the shot, performs a multifaceted position throughout firing. Its design variations contribute considerably to shot sample effectivity, velocity consistency, and general effectiveness in goal capturing functions. Understanding the connection between wad sort and efficiency is crucial for optimizing ammunition choice.

  • Efficiency Optimization: Shot Sample and Velocity

    The first operate of the wad is to effectively switch power from the burning powder to the shot column, propelling the shot down the barrel. Totally different wad designs obtain this power switch with various levels of effectivity, impacting each the shot sample and velocity. For instance, a wad designed for tighter patterns will usually maintain the shot column collectively longer, leading to a denser shot cloud at longer ranges. Conversely, wads designed for wider patterns could enable the shot to disperse extra rapidly, proving advantageous in disciplines like skeet capturing. Wad choice additionally influences velocity consistency, a vital consider attaining predictable goal breaks.

  • Materials Composition: Felt, Plastic, and Hybrids

    Wad supplies vary from conventional felt wads to fashionable plastic and hybrid designs. Every materials displays distinctive traits affecting efficiency. Felt wads, whereas nonetheless utilized in some functions, are typically much less environment friendly than plastic wads when it comes to power switch and sample consistency. Plastic wads, typically incorporating intricate cup and petal designs, provide superior sealing and shot safety, contributing to extra constant velocities and tighter patterns. Hybrid wads mix parts of each felt and plastic, looking for to steadiness efficiency traits and cost-effectiveness.

  • Specialised Wad Designs: Particular Purposes

    Specialised wads cater to particular goal capturing disciplines and shot sorts. For instance, wads designed for metal shot typically incorporate options to mitigate shot deformation and enhance sample efficiency attributable to metal’s decrease density in comparison with lead. Equally, wads designed for entice capturing could prioritize tighter patterns at longer ranges, whereas skeet-specific wads could give attention to faster shot dispersion for nearer targets. These specialised designs underscore the significance of matching wad sort to the supposed software.

  • Environmental Issues: Biodegradability and Materials Selections

    Environmental consciousness has influenced wad materials growth. Conventional felt wads, being biodegradable, current a decrease environmental influence in comparison with some plastic wads. Nevertheless, developments in polymer expertise have led to the event of biodegradable plastic wads, addressing environmental issues with out compromising efficiency. The rising availability of eco-friendly wad supplies displays the rising emphasis on sustainable practices throughout the capturing sports activities neighborhood.

Optimizing Efficiency with 12-Gauge Goal Masses

The next suggestions present sensible steering for maximizing effectiveness and attaining constant outcomes when utilizing 12-gauge goal hundreds, particularly specializing in enhancing accuracy and general capturing proficiency.

Tip 1: Correct Shotgun Match is Paramount

A correctly fitted shotgun is prime to correct capturing. A gun that matches poorly can result in inconsistent cheek weld, improper sight alignment, and elevated perceived recoil. Skilled gun becoming is really helpful to optimize gun mount and general capturing mechanics.

Tip 2: Choke Choice Influences Shot Sample

Choke choice considerably impacts shot sample distribution. Tighter chokes constrict the shot sample, leading to denser shot clouds at longer ranges, appropriate for entice capturing. Extra open chokes produce wider patterns, useful for nearer targets in skeet capturing. Matching choke to the particular self-discipline and goal distance is crucial.

Tip 3: Ammunition Choice Ought to Complement the Taking pictures Self-discipline

Particular goal load traits, together with shot measurement, velocity, and wad sort, ought to complement the chosen self-discipline. Entice capturing usually advantages from bigger shot sizes and better velocities, whereas skeet capturing could favor smaller shot and barely decrease velocities. Understanding these nuances is vital to optimized efficiency.

Tip 4: Constant Taking pictures Mechanics Promote Accuracy

Constant gun mount, stance, and follow-through contribute considerably to accuracy. Creating and sustaining constant capturing mechanics, together with correct weight distribution and easy swing, minimizes variables and promotes repeatable outcomes.

Tip 5: Follow and Sample Testing Refine Efficiency

Common observe and sample testing are essential for refining capturing method and understanding ammunition efficiency. Sample testing reveals the shot distribution at varied distances, permitting for knowledgeable choke and ammunition choice. Devoted observe reinforces correct mechanics and builds confidence.

Tip 6: Eye Dominance Performs a Essential Function

Understanding eye dominance, whether or not proper or left-eye dominant, ensures correct sight alignment. Aligning the dominant eye with the shotgun’s rib promotes correct goal acquisition and reduces cross-firing tendencies. Eye dominance assessments can simply decide dominant eye.

Tip 7: Environmental Elements Affect Efficiency

Wind situations, temperature, and humidity can affect shot trajectory and goal breakage. Take into account these elements, particularly at longer ranges, and make mandatory changes to carry factors and capturing strategies for optimum outcomes.
